Output d2415203799a4ef1b7623498c7558a68ca9269aa9539f6c45ee3166fe294746e:2

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d0a61848f4a5769aad312b3f8e0e1f6627e7901 OP_EQUAL
address
37FmaXQM2aXB4LBSPcWAXipXLtwm1hKufT
transaction
d2415203799a4ef1b7623498c7558a68ca9269aa9539f6c45ee3166fe294746e
spent
true